Nate Kulina (played by Nick Jonas) is a young MMA fighter who happens to be gay. He's a pretty compelling character in himself and I'm happy that his character's struggles did not revolve around simply being gay as some earlier LGBTQ+ characters' stories were. However, living in such a "macho" world and simultaneously living openly as a gay man clearly scares the shit out of Nate and he knows there would be consequences if he ever comes out. Essentially, he goes through 30 episodes without telling a single person besides Will (his sort of love interest bc he's not really a boyfriend and it's kind of fucked up how they know each other at all) that he is gay and that's only because Jay (his older brother played by Jonathan Tucker) happens to come across evidence that Nate is hiding his sexuality from the world. Nate has nothing to worry about though because Jay is fully accepting- even if he does make some cringey jokes about Nate's sex life at the end.
